导出Zookeeper数据
接口功能介绍
导出Zookeeper数据
接口约束
无
URI
GET /v1/zookeeper/data/export
路径参数
无
Query参数
参数 | 是否必填 | 参数类型 | 说明 | 示例 | 下级对象 |
---|---|---|---|---|---|
instanceId | 是 | String | 实例ID | abc36594d0c44fd3a252e56c8e57e6c6 | |
type | 是 | String | 文件类型 | snapshot/transaction_log |
请求参数
请求头header参数
参数 | 是否必填 | 参数类型 | 说明 | 示例 | 下级对象 |
---|---|---|---|---|---|
regionId | 是 | String | 资源池 ID | d8bbd132b53a11e9b0e40242ac110002 |
请求体body参数
无
响应参数
参数 | 参数类型 | 说明 | 示例 | 下级对象 |
---|---|---|---|---|
statusCode | Integer | 返回状态码(2000成功,5000系统错误,18xxxx业务错误) | 1000 | |
error | String | 业务错误码,RCC_statusCode | RCC_1000 | |
message | String | 返回结果描述 | invalid param | |
returnObj | Array of Objects | 返回数据体 | returnObj |
表 returnObj
参数 | 参数类型 | 说明 | 示例 | 下级对象 |
---|---|---|---|---|
type | String | 文件类型 | snapshot | |
size | Long | 文件大小,单位为B | 40 | |
bucket | String | 存储桶 | 49d7ad25e4cf06284fe6c0007fe33508 | |
fileKey | String | 存储key | snapshot.3000000005 | |
md5 | String | 文件md5 | 55c13a0e55cfde55acbcf6bf4c3bfc5a |
枚举参数
无
请求示例
请求url
http://endpoint/v1/zookeeper/data/export?instanceId=1&type=snapshot
请求头header
{"regionId": "d8bbd132b53a11e9b0e40242ac110002"}
请求体body
无
响应示例
{"returnObj": [{"bucket": "68ab6e75d7f847c2b938ec4460b78cf6","fileKey": "log.100000001","md5": null,"size": null,"type": 2},{"bucket": "68ab6e75d7f847c2b938ec4460b78cf6","fileKey": null,"md5": null,"size": null,"type": 2}],"error": "","message": "SUCCESS","statusCode": 2000}